On my Tiger I currently have '95 Mustang (Cobra) rear discs and calipers. The main features that pulled me there was that the disc bolt pattern matched what I'm currently using (5 on 4 1/2) and that the calipers had cable parking brake actuation of the pads in addition to the hydraulic pistons.
But those discs are too large for a 13 inch application. At the time I did the conversion, I traded in a set of '85-87 Toyota Corolla GT-S (AE86 series) rear disc calipers, which also had a cable parking brake. The Corollas of that era had 14 inch OEM wheels but I'm pretty sure some people used 13 inch wheels on them for autocross purposes.
Toyota made approximately a zillion of those cars so they might still be a good aftermarket pick for a rear disc caliper.
